Pharmacy Technician education is available in programs that last anywhere from 6 months to 2 years or more, depending on the depth of training.
Like many other clinical training and technical programs in Taneyville MO, the much shorter programs offer a fundamental, essential introduction of exactly what to expect on the job and general education associating with fundamental pharmacology, pharmacology law, pharmacology records, stock, identifying, ordering and many other appropriate topics to working in a retail pharmacy environment.
Courses and diploma programs
Students that go to the shorter programs normally earn a Pharmacy Technician Certificate for completion of the program, but have no actual accepted certifications.
Longer courses provided by schools in Taneyville MOinclude specialized diploma programs and Associates Degree courses that last in between about 12 months to 24 months.
Diploma programs are excellent for students who already have some health care service experience and want to move into a position as a PT, as well as those entering the field new.
Research study generally includes all that is mentioned above, plus pharmacology in more detail, dosage computation, blending medicines and others, and generally includes an externship to prepare students to take the accreditation examination. Students finishing a diploma course and passing their certification examination will make the title of Certified Pharmacy Technician or CPhT.
Associates in Health Sciences with a PT specialized takes 2 years and is suggested for any specific if there is an interest in both acquiring a college degree, and being able to advance the fastest in their occupation.
Courses of study are much more in depth and consist of additional medical patients. Externships are a necessary part of the curriculum, as is passing the certification examination. Those with their CPhT and an AS degree stand the best possibility of being hired in non-retail pharmacy technician positions, and beginning at the highest wages.
Accredited professional program
In the UK and numerous other nations a pharmacy technician is required to complete both a recognized professional program in pharmacy services and a pharmaceutical science program, and have to be registered with various UK health care companies.
Courses of study include that which is mentioned above, along with medicines management for patients and training in running and aiding in hospital centers and even more.
Please note however, in the UK there is a distinction in between a pharmacy technician and a pharmacy dispenser, with the former having more employment and educational requirements.

Employment After Attending PT Schools
There are actually lots of even more employment possibility for PTs than lot of people presume. While the majority of jobs are in retail pharmacy positions there are a lot more specific profession alternatives for pharmacy techs with the right training.
Hospitals, medicine production and packing companies, medicine compounding pharmacies, nursing houses, psychiatric facilities and any kind of clinical facility that either fills medicine prescriptions or dispenses medicines straight to patients make use of pharmacy technicians.
These positions can be very fulfilling, and tend to pay even more too. Certain qualified professionals also have the ability to counsel consumers and patients on the use of their medicines, along with answer medicine questions.
